HOW TWUC SUPPORTS OUR MEMBERS
- Powerful advocacy in support of writers’ rights
- Connection with a community of professional writers across the country
- Increased income opportunities through public and school readings programs
- Free professional development resources and how-to guides
- Be paid to mentor, or be mentored by, another writer through the Union's Mentorship Microgrants
- Access to dedicated staff for contract advice and grievance assistance

Vasto Arts Workshop
Vasto, a historic town on Italy’s Adriatic Coast, hosts a week-long creative writing workshop with Canadian authors Chris Di Raddo and Carolyn Marie Souaid. Held from September 6-13, 2025, sessions take place Monday to Friday, both morning and afternoon, with a break for lunch. The program includes…
